I'm lactose intolerant and want to start making smoothies. Anyone have any good recipes? I'd like some that are for fresh fruits and ones for frozen fruits too. Thanks
I recommend putting in spinach in your smoothie in addition to fruit. It may sound strange, but you cannot really taste the spinach, but you get all of the benefits! It's a great source of iron and calcium.
My suggestions:
1 banana
1/2 cup of frozen blueberries (or other fruit)
handful of spinach
1 cup of rice milk or almond milk (I like soy too)!
* vanilla protein powder (if you want some extra protein)

I drink green smoothies almost every day. love them. I don't use any milk, just fruit and greens.
This is my basic recipe:
1 orange
1 banana
1 c. frozen fruit mix (pineapple, peach, strawberries and mango)
3 or 4 large handfuls of baby spinach or other greens (romaine, kale, etc)
Blend the fresh fruit with a bit of water. Add the frozen fruit and blend. Add the greens and blend. Drink and enjoy!
If you have a high powered blender you could probably throw it all in at once. I, obvisouly, do not!
